Personal Income Tax
·         More people to be brought in to the tax Net ( currently ONLY approx 3% people pay tax)
·         Reduce the existing rate of Taxation 2.5 to 5 Lakh  ( Rate of Tax = 5% reduced from 10% earlier)
·         0% liability for Income below 3 Lakh and 2500 for 3 to 3.5 Lakh
·         Additional 10% surcharge on people earnings above 50+ lakhs
·         Anyone filing the tax for 1st time will not be scrutinized for there declaration in first year

Some real Interesting Data mining results and Facts from De-Monetization
  • 76 Lakh people are earning more than 5 Lakh as per tax collection
  • Out of this 55 Lakh are salaried
  • 10+ lakh income = 24 Lakh ppl
  • 20+ Lakh Income declared by only 1.72 Lakh people
  • Contrary to all this 1.2 Crore cars sold ( How is this possible???) 
  • 1.48 Lakh accounts had got 80+ lakh rupees during demonetization
  • The best part is that 3.1 Crore people travelled Abroad although, only 2 Lac people earn 20+ Lac rupees.

Political Funding Reforms, a Strong move by govt. in political funding. 

  • Max cash donation reduced from 20k to 2k from any source
  • Donation to be received by Cheque or by electronic mode
  • Electoral Bonds can be purchased from Bank - redeemable for a political party
  • Political Parties to file ITR as per the timing guidelines
  • With Transparency in Political party Income declaration, tax rebates will be given
